Phylum Bacillota (Firmicutes), Class Bacilli, Order Bacillales, Family Staphylococcaceae, Genus Staphylococcus, Staphylococcus
chromogenes Hajek et al. 1987.
Old synonym: Staphylococcus hyicus subsp. chromogenes Devriese et al. 1978.
Gram-positive cocci, 0,8-1 μm, nonmotile, nonsporing. Occur singly, in pairs, tetrads
or clusters.
Colonies are nonhemolytic, yellow / orange pigmented, glistening, butyrous, with
entire margins, 4–7 mm diameter. Some strains isolated mainly from swine may not
be pigmented. Facultatively anaerobic. Optimum growth temperature 37 ºC. Grow on
media: P agar, Trypticase Soy Agar ± 5% sheep blood, Chapman (selective medium
with 75 g/l NaCl & mannitol), Mueller-Hinton agar. Growth in medium containing 10%
NaCl, but no growth or only weak growth at 15% NaCl.
Isolated from swine, cattle and birds skin, from ruminants’ milk, rarely from humans.
Susceptible to Novobiocin.
Low pathogenicity - dermatitis / superficial lesions and subclinical mastitis. Together
with other staphylococci may be involved in ‘Chronic Fatigue Syndrome’ in humans
(also, experiments in dogs show same clinical aspect).

Positive results for nitrate reduction, alkaline phosphatase, arginine dihydrolase,
deoxyribonuclease, catalase, acid production from: mannose, lactose, trehalose,
galactose, glucose, glycerol, ribose and fructose.
Negative results for oxidase, acetoin production, hyaluronidase, coagulase-rabbit
plasma, clumping factor, fibrinolysin, heat-stable nuclease, beta-glucuronidase,
beta-galactosidase, H2S production, indole production, Tween 80 hydrolysis, acid
production from: xylitol, raffinose, xylose, arabinose, cellobiose, fucose, salicin,
tagatose and melezitose.
Variable results for urease, beta-glucosidase, acid production from mannitol and
turanose.
